Update.... Part way throug our drive to san diego from vegas. Average speed of 75-80 and average fuel consumption is about 18 miles per gallon!! Pretty happy bout that. Vegas69's home alignment is great!!

phillym5 11-08-2009 10:54 PM

We made it!!
Only one problem we had..... we got jammed up in traffic for quite some time... then it started going up a 5 mile hill. Stop and go was starting to kill my calf.. but no big deal. 1/4 way up the hill.. i started smelling clutch. (you have to realize that it was clutch in clutch out for 10 miles.. then 2 miles up the hill... just slippin it for miles)... Then shortly after the smell... i saw some smoke coming from the car. Imediatly pulled over and shut her down. Well... after letting the clutch cool for a bit.. it would not disengage. Everything must have gotten to hot and expanded. We had to sit there for an hour... then put the car in reverse... and cranked it a few times. Finally it broke loose. Just as that happened.. a highway patrol pulled up and blocked all the lanes so we could whip accross traffic and hit the exit for a well needed Pizza hut stop. lol. He didn't even mention the no plate... or the brake light that was out. (who says you need a damn plate!!)

Then once back on the road.. she cruised down the 15 running 85mph in 6th at 1900 rpms flawlessly.:cool:

Still need to fix the axle seal... its not as bad as it was... but its still drippin back there. Other than that... thing seem real good. Never got hotter than 190's.. even sitting in that damn traffic. Im pretty happy about that.:captain:

Pretty much. There is still a slight valve cover leak... and the suspension creaks a bit... but things seem to be pretty good. I have been daily driving her.
I did have to modify my control arms... on hard turns the lower control arms were digging into the rotors. Strange because the exact set up was used prior with no issues. Only thing that was changed was we added drop spindles.
Other than that... i really enjoy driving the camaro.
